Would they have met, without the theatre? One grew up in a village in Berry, the daughter of Communist teachers. The other, youngest in a Catholic family, comfortably off, was born in Belgium. Their paths crossed at the Brussels Conservatoire. For although they came from completely opposing worlds, Magali Pinglaut and Valérie Bauchau both shared a love of the theatre. The piece was born from this unlikely, almost miraculous friendship, which challenges the obvious.
On the stage, they revisit the paths they have taken, blending personal memories, and great History. For the one, theatre is shown as a region of emancipation and deconstruction, in which othernesses can dialogue. For the other, it is to highlight the “humble ones” of families, especially the women who bear the social struggles.
In order to orchestrate this dual partition, they called on Isabelle Pousseur. A leading figure in theatrical direction, she brings her keen gaze and stage experience to the piece. Alongside her, Jean-Baptiste Delcourt completes the team, offering a valuable outsider perspective. Hence, Du côté de chez Elle(s) brilliantly celebrates the fertile friendships which leave their enduring mark.
